I didn’t expect the main store to be closed. Then again, the shack was open half a block away. When I arrived, they had just sold out of the brisket (left me a little disappointed). Fortunately, the Three Bone Rib combo was still available and I found it to be pretty good. The rib sauce was a great blend of sweet and spicy, adding even more flavor to the ribs. The potato salad was a nice cool contrast to the cooked foods in my combo. And the beans were supplemented by some chunks of ground beef and jalapeños, an excellent choice. The next time I go, I’ll have to be sure to arrive earlier to have more options available. And hopefully the main sit-in restaurant area will be open.

No better restaurant on planet earth. Do you think I'm exaggerating? I have never been to Iowa, but I know they are the best. I was in my old Korean War veteran father's home in North Fort Myers when Hurricane Ian hit. I am third generation from Fort Myers. Fort Myers had no surge from any hurricane in 111 years before Hurricane Ian. We went underwater. Miles up the Caloosahatchee River where my dad grew up, our entire neighborhood went underwater. My dad lost all his worldly possessions. We had no food, no water, no electricity, no cell phone service. We had nothing but destruction. In the weeks after, no national charity showed up to help at ground zero of hurricane Ian. We never saw red cross, salvation army or any other national charity that begged for people to send money to help the victims of hurricane Ian. Who did we see help? Two groups: the local Ocean Church (handing out subs and drinks door to door to people who lost everything) and some people who set up a BBQ stand in the local parking lot of Big Lots. All I remembered was a big Q on their trailer. They handed out amazing meals for free to our locals who lost their homes and everything else. We had nothing to eat and here they were handing out amazing meals for free. I could not find them for years, but I'm so grateful I have now. I will never forget what you did for our people in Florida after the worst tragedy...

I wish I could give a glowing report like everyone else. Unfortunately our experience has left me confident I won't be using Willie Ray's in the future. I ordered 16 lunches for a work function. I called on Tuesday and gave the order for Friday. I called on Thursday and confirmed the order and again stated we would be arriving at 11 to pick up our food. The food was not ready until 1130. I had 16 people at the office ready to eat food at 1130. There are lunch specials on the website for a different item each day. 8-10 dollars with 2 sides. When our total came to 260 some dollars which was 100 dollars more than I had anticipated Willie told me he couldn't run a business and make money if he sold lunches for 8-10 dollars and when I pointed out that is what his website quoted he said he wasn't aware of that and if it did then it wouldn't come with 2 sides and I said it is in writing on your website it comes with 2 sides! He basically did not care and ended the conversation. I was disappointed that someone that is so appreciative of social media recognition for the positive things he does is not aware of his own website content. He hasn’t up dated pricing so beware of pricing increase on your receipt! The least he could do is honor the price when someone questions it. In the future we will utilize a...
